Geobacter sulfurreducens as model organism
Primary goal: optimize the electron shuffle
E. coli as a chassis to substitute for Geobacter Genome already contains key proteins in pathway
Lacks outer membrane cytochromes

Dr. Derek Lovely: Research with Geobacter
e- transport without pilin gene
Dr. Alfred Spormann: Research with Shewanella
Cloned omcB-like gene into E. coli
Generated current

Parts Added to Registry
omcB: BBa_K269000
omcE: BBa_K269001
omcS: BBa_K269002
omcT: BBa_K269003
Cloned into pCR2.1/ All sequenced
Objective is to clone all 4 genes with Ribosome binding sites into one plasmid
All parts meet safety requirements
Geobacter is a biosafety level 1 organism

Challenges
Anaerobic nature of Geobacter
Solubility of Nafion membrane
Host vector has an extra PstI site complicating removal of omc genes for ligation into RBS vector
Ligation/transformation inefficiency
![Page 25: A Synthetic Biology Approach to Microbial Fuel Cell ...2009.igem.org/files/presentation/Missouri_Miners.pdf · Fig. 2 –Modified from Macmillan Publishers Ltd., Derek Lovely: Bugjuice:](https://reader031.vdocuments.net/reader031/viewer/2022022504/5ab457da7f8b9adc638bf79b/html5/thumbnails/25.jpg)
Future Work
Testing the system and modeling
Determine redox potential for each cytochrome
Electron transport based on redox potential for each new cytochrome and existing electron transfer proteins in E. coli
Possible coupling of Shewanella
oneidensis or Geobacter
sulfurreducens with our new
E. coli strain to improve efficiency
